The United States is the largest contributor to the United Nations core budget, accounting for 22%. February, The White House announces The U.S. membership of all international organizations, conventions and treaties, including the United Nations, was conducted for a six-month review to reduce or end funds-and potentially cancel funds. Deadline deadlines for decapitation drop next month.
Trump’s abolition The scrapping of the United States International Development Agency (USAID), as well as most aid programs, has seriously undermined unleased and unsupported humanitarian actions that rely on discretionary funding. The United States is not expected to withdraw completely from the United Nations (although there is nothing impossible for this isolationist, supranationalist president). But Trump’s hostile intentions are obvious. His budget proposal for 2026 Of all U.S. international spending, 83.7% cuts are sought – from $58.7 billion to $9.6 billion. This includes a reduction of 87% of the United Nations funding, both mandatory and discretionary funds. “In 2023, All The United States spends about $13 billion in the United Nations. That’s equivalent to 1.6% of the Pentagon budget that year ($816 million) or About two-thirds The money Americans spend on ice cream every year. ” Carnegie International Peace Donation. Economic development assistance, disaster relief and family planning programs will be eliminated.

Key joint agencies in the shooting line include UNICEF, UNICEF – At times when the risks faced by babies and children are daunting; World Food Program (WFP), which could lose 30% of its staff; agencies dealing with refugees and immigration are also shrinking; International Court of Justice (“World Court”), which illustrates Israel’s illegal actions in Gaza; and the International Atomic Energy Agency, which monitors nuclear activities of Iran and others.
Trump has boycotted the World Health Organization, the Palestinian Relief Agency (UNFA) and the UN Human Rights Commission $4 billion was cancelled allocated to the UN Climate Fund, claiming that all actions violate U.S. interests. If his budget is adopted this fall, the UN’s 2030 Sustainable Development Goals It may prove to be impossible. The U.S. financial support for international peacekeeping and observer missions at fault points such as Lebanon, the Democratic Republic of the Congo and Kosovo, which currently accounts for 26% of total spending, will fall to zero.
From Somalia, Sudan to Bangladesh and Haiti, withdrawing USDA support has proven to be fatal. UN officials describe situations of conflict-style aid after earthquakes Myanmar is a “humanitarian disaster”. Research published on the Lancet finds Trump’s cuts could lead to More than 14 million people died By 2030, one-third of them will be children.
WFPThe world’s largest food aid provider says it is expected to have a funding deficit of $8.1 billion this year Acute hunger A record 343 million people impacted in 74 countries. Other donor countries failed to fill the gap left by the United States. So far in 2025, $46.2 billion has been proposed for 44 unconditional crises. Recently, the UK Cut aid budget Pay £6 billion and pay for nuclear bombs.
The UN chief acknowledged many of Trump’s early problems. Secretary-General António Guterres has initiated Thousands of layoffs AsUN80The reform plan consolidates the core budget and reduces the core budget by as much as 20%. However, Guterres said the serious challenge was the destructive attitude of member states, namely undermining multilateral cooperation, violating rules, failing to pay for their share and forgetting the reasons why the United Nations was first established. This is not an order menu. This is the bedrock of international relations,” he said.
